Sylar's ability is called "intuitive aptitude". He "understands" how things work. He opens a special's head and "sees" how their ability works. This is why he's more adept with their ability than even they were. He CAN acquire abilities via empathy, like Peter used to, but it's only been done twice now and it's somewhat vague WHY he can do that.
The only benefit you could get from Sylar's power would be to understand how things work. This is why he can tell when a clock isn't working and he can fix it with ease. About Wolverine.
